There are requirements, however,
that allow emotional support animals to be allowed in homes, even no pet rental units.
Even if the apartment or home that is being rented does not allow pets, they are legally required to
allow emotional support animals, and the renter can not be charged an extra fee or deposit (however, they can still be charged for any damage created by the animal).
If a landlord fails to
allow an emotional support animal in rental housing for a person who qualifies under the statutes, the landlord violates the statutes and could owe damages to the disabled tenant.
If a person claims she needs an emotional support animal and has a prescription from a licensed mental health professional, the Fair Housing Amendments Act of 1988 requires the community association to make a «reasonable accommodation» to their policies and
allow the emotional support animal.
